Census Tract 28047002900: frequently asked questions

What is the typical home value in Census Tract 28047002900?
The estimated median home value in Census Tract 28047002900 today is $409,671, higher than 58% of U.S. tracts.
How much is property tax in Census Tract 28047002900?
The median annual property tax in Census Tract 28047002900 is $2,467, an effective rate of 0.71% of home value.
Is Census Tract 28047002900 expensive to live in?
Homes in Census Tract 28047002900 cost about 3.57× the median household income, near the U.S. tracts median.
What is the average rent in Census Tract 28047002900?
The median gross rent in Census Tract 28047002900 is $1,144 a month, lower than 62% of U.S. tracts.
How much have home prices grown in Census Tract 28047002900?
Home prices in Census Tract 28047002900 have moved 57% over the past five years (-10% in the past year), per the FHFA House Price Index.
How many people live in Census Tract 28047002900?
Census Tract 28047002900 has a population of 1,921, about 756.15 people per square mile, per the U.S. Census American Community Survey. The median age is 48.
What is the weather like in Census Tract 28047002900?
Census Tract 28047002900 averages 68.4°F year-round, summer highs near 89.1°F, winter lows around 45.4°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 0.2 inches of snow a year.
Is Census Tract 28047002900 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
Census Tract 28047002900's FEMA National Risk Index score is 70.9 (higher than 71% of U.S. tracts).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is hurricane. Expected annual loss from flooding is $0.11 per $1,000 of building value.
